Forged from farrier's hoof rasp, this tomahawk has some
of the rasp's teeth visible along the poll. The well-figured curly
maple haft is finished with aqua fortis stain to accentuate the grain.
Forge welding the high carbon heads requires a careful regulation of the
heat. The steel must be just hot enough to weld without removing all
the carbon ("decarburizing") or burning up all together.
